The national median salary for a Legal Operations Manager is $130,000 per year. Entry-level positions typically start at $95,000, while experienced professionals in the top 25% earn $170,000 or more. The highest-paid 10% of Legal Operations Managers nationally earn $220,000+.
Education and requirements
Bachelor's or JD; project management experience. This role is 50% remote-eligible nationally, which significantly expands the geographic job market for workers in lower cost-of-living cities.
Salary growth outlook
Legal Operations Manager compensation is growing at 6.5% annually, well above the national average wage growth rate. Demand for qualified Legal Operations Managers significantly outpaces supply in most major metros.
